Associative play
Associative plays are the kinds of play that doesn't need an established plan, organizational system or competition. It can appear as simple as a small group of kids riding bikes together. Because it doesn't have to be the use of a plan, it's great even for the youngest children. In addition, it can foster social skills, such as answering and asking questions.
Associative playing is an excellent method to boost the brain development of your child. It helps them develop important capabilities like critical thinking, collaboration with others, and solving problems. They also build more adaptable and resilient personalities. In fact, research has revealed that associative play can help children to cope with an array of scenarios.
Children usually begin associative play around the age of three. It involves playing with others and performing regular activities, such as sharing materials or running in circles. Also, they play with toys. While they're a little chaotic, playing with others encourages teamwork and communication. It's a great method to let your child get exercise while learning about their world.
In this kind of game, the older kid assumes the responsibility of the leader and organizer. They alternate borrowing play equipment. They learn to share their toys and respect other people. Associative games also improve problem-solving abilities and assists kids make friends. Additionally, it can help the development of their language skills.
It is different from parallel play and is a structured activity where kids interact with their peers. Associative games involve children talking and engaging in a joint activity while parallel play focuses on children playing independently.

Cyberbullying
Cyberbullying can be described as a form of online harassment. It could start by posting a brief Facebook post or text message. Many kids don't know how quickly a tiny teasing can develop into a full-blown cyberbullying attack. The intangibility of cyberbullying is easier to commit because there's no face-to face interaction. Additionally, it doesn't have the emotional affect that traditional bullying has.
Parents can reduce the risk of cyberbullying by monitoring your child's online activities. They should also discuss with their children about not sharing explicit photos on the internet. Often, teens lose control over their privacy and then become victimized by name-calling and shame. You can also conduct a quick Google search to determine whether your child is using a social media account. If it's private, the account will not appear on.
Cyberbullying may cause a range of mental and physical consequences. It can cause children to shut down from their group or have negative self-talk. The effects could result in sleepless nights. Other symptoms could be stomach aches, headaches, and loss of motivation. Regardless of the cause of the bullying, victims of cyberbullying need to know that they're not isolated in their battle with bullying.
Cyberbullying at school isn't all that obvious as you might think. It is often difficult to spot, but there are steps parents can take in order to reduce its impact. The first step is to create boundaries for your child's online activity. Set up limits on time and keep online activities out of public areas to allow you to watch for any signs of cyberbullying.
If your child has been victimized by cyberbullying You should contact the school's management and seek out help. The school might not be able to assist, however counsel and mental wellness services are able to help. In addition, don't be afraid to confront the person responsible for the violence; rather, submit the incident to the school.
